The muon detector of the L3 experiment consists of 80 large drift chamber modules. In order to reach the quality aimed for, three systems have been developed: 1. a time calibration system TOCAL; 2. an electro-optical system RASNIK for the alignment of the wires in the chambers; 3. a display system Simple Watch for the detection of excess current indicating a HV breakdown.
